Baptism is one of the greatest gifts that God has given us, and one of the greatest gifts that parents can give to their children. Through Baptism, a person is united to the saving death and resurrection of Jesus Christ; or, to put it another way, what Jesus did for us by dying and rising from the dead is applied individually to the baptized person.
When someone is baptized, the risen life of the Lord Jesus begins to live in that person’s soul. This person begins the adventure of the Christian life, in which he or she is called to become like Jesus Himself. It is our union with the Lord Jesus, which begins with Baptism, that gives us the hope of heaven.
Baptism, then, is so much more than just a "naming ceremony" or a blessing for a new child. It should be the highest priority of every Christian parent to see that their child is baptized very early in his/her earthly life. Because of the importance of Baptism, this sacrament is approached with great reverence and care at Blessed Trinity Catholic Parish.
To begin the baptismal preparation process please complete the form below.
1. Register your child for baptism by completing the "Request Form for Infant Baptism" below.
2. Once the form is recieved, Fr. Joe will reach out to schedule a meeting so that he can get to know you and describe the preparation process. At this time, a hoped-for date of baptism can be discussed.
3. Enroll in pre-Baptismal classes online at CatholicBaptismPrep.com. This will take approximately 10 days to complete and costs $65. Please include fr.joseph.baker@btcatholic.us as the parish contact, as the church will receive a copy of your participation certificate via email.
4. Obtain bulletins from Masses for 4 consecutive weeks (either at Blessed Trinity or elsewhere) and bring them to your follow-up meeting with the pastor.
5. Have each Catholic Godparent (Sponsor) complete the Sponsor Guidelines and Certificate Form, have it signed by their pastor, and return it to the parish secretary at least 10 days prior to the date of the baptism. A $25.00 fee to help defray the cost of materials for the baptism must also be paid to the parish secretary at least 10 days prior to the date of baptism.
6. Schedule and attend a follow-up meeting with the pastor at least 2 weeks before the hoped-for date of baptism.
